SLU-PP-332 (C18H14N2O2, CAS: 303760-60-3) is a groundbreaking research compound acting as a potent ERR receptor agonist that mimics the effects of intense exercise in preclinical models. The substance activates metabolic pathways responsible for fat burning, energy production, and endurance building. Studies show that SLU-PP-332 significantly accelerates metabolism, increases aerobic capacity, and reduces adipose tissue in laboratory models, making it an ideal subject for research into physical performance optimization.

How SLU-PP-332 Works
- ERR Receptor Activation: SLU-PP-332 precisely binds to ERRα, ERRβ, and ERRγ receptors, triggering a metabolic cascade that increases fat burning and energy production in preclinical models.
- Mitochondria Building: Drastically increases the number and efficiency of mitochondria in muscle cells, translating to greater power and endurance in studies.
- Burning Fat for Fuel: Switches metabolism to utilize fatty acids as the primary energy source, leading to adipose tissue reduction in research models.
- Training Effect Without Effort: Activates exactly the same genetic programs as intense endurance training, even when the model remains physically inactive.
- Muscle Fiber Transformation: Increases the proportion of Type IIa fibers (endurance-strength), improving both strength and performance in preclinical studies.
